Why Tulisa will continue to save Misha
Onestepawayfrom
20-11-2011
I just wanted to point something out that has been bothering me about Tulisa's judging ability. Does anyone notice that she brings her own bias into her judging? A prime example of this was displayed when she chose to save Misha over Kitty last week simply because she has a similar musical background to Misha. So that means that if any of the other acts barring Little mix for obvious reasons face Miss B in the sing off, Tulisa will opt to vote them out because the likes of Janet and Craig are not R n B artists. This makes the whole concept of the sing off redundant when judges have already made their mind up before the mouths of the artists open in the sing off and quite frankly, it's shameful. Any opinions on this?
